OEM Inc. today announced that Jammit will have a presence at CES 2010. Jammit is an iPhone and iPod touch application that enables users to listen, remix, learn, and play along with master recordings of new and old rock songs. At CES, Jammit will be providing hands-on demos of the application on iPods loaded with all available apps. There will also be merchandise giveaways, including t-shirts, at the demo booth.
CES will be held in the Las Vegas Convention Center from January 7-10, 2010. On those dates, Jammit will be in booth #4322 in the iLounge Pavilion (North Hall in the Las Vegas Convention Center) to demo the iPhone app.
Aspiring drum, bass, and guitar players can learn from 24 master recordings of their favorite artists, including classics like Deep Purple's "Smoke on the Water," James Gang’s “Funk 49” and recent hits like Fall Out Boy’s “Thnks Fr Th Mmrs.” Jammit also features a four channel mixer, slow mode, a synchronized notation page, a loop page, and a built-in recorder. Additional song packs will be released on a continuous basis.

About Jammit
Available for the iPhone and iPod touch, Jammit is an application that formats the master recordings of your favorite songs with easy-to-read, synced notation and the unique capability to rebalance the mix. Listen to the guitar part by itself, and you’ll learn how to play it exactly the way it was recorded by the original artist. Jammit features a wide variety of popular songs from classic and cutting edge artists.
